E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ases the grandeur of Castle Gordon, engraved by Robert Sands in 1837. Located near Fochabers in Moray, Scotland, this magnificent castle served as the principal seat of the Dukes of Gordon. The image captures the essence of this stately home, which was one of the largest country houses ever built in Scotland after its reconstruction by John Baxter in the 1760s.
